James Kenneth Eddy 1912 - 1978

James Kenneth Eddy of Honolulu, Honolulu County, Hawaii was born on April 15, 1912, and died at age 66 years old on June 3, 1978. James Eddy was buried at National Memorial Cemetery Of The Pacific Section I Site 208 2177 Puowaina Drive, in Honolulu.

Did you know?
In 1912, in the year that James Kenneth Eddy was born, the Girl Scouts of the USA was started by Juliette Gordon Low with the help of Sir Robert Baden-Powell, the founder of Boy Scouts in Great Britain. She said after a meeting with Baden-Powell, "I've got something for the girls of Savannah, and all of America, and all the world, and we're going to start it tonight!" And she did.
